aravindreddyravula Goto Github PK
Name: Aravind Reddy Ravula
Type: User
Bio: SMTS at Oracle || MS in CS at Stony Brook University || B.Tech in CS at JNTUH College of Engineering
Twitter: AravindReddyR
Location: Seattle, WA
Name: Aravind Reddy Ravula
Type: User
Bio: SMTS at Oracle || MS in CS at Stony Brook University || B.Tech in CS at JNTUH College of Engineering
Twitter: AravindReddyR
Location: Seattle, WA
Application Performance Optimization Summary
AutoSuggest C Program which uses Trie Data Structure to efficiently suggest similar words based on user input.
The Patterns of Scalable, Reliable, and Performant Large-Scale Systems
Designed & Developed a stackable file system on top of linux file system. Helps in taking backups for the files updated based on space based retention policy.
A complete computer science study plan to become a software engineer.
Implementation of the paper "DeepAnnotator: Genome Annotation with Deep Learning"
classic books of computer science
I have implemented a Linux Kernel Module which supports a sys_cpenc system call. This system call supports three operations copy, encrytion and decryption.
Self-contained, multi-threaded fasta/q parser
git-tuorial
KmerEstimate: A Streaming Algorithm for Estimating k-mer Counts with Optimal Space Usage - Parallel Implementation
Code and resources for Machine Learning for Algorithmic Trading, 2nd edition.
Machine Learning notebooks for refreshing concepts.
Implemented Pagerank and Sparse Matrix Multiplication in Tensorflow.
VIP cheatsheets for Stanford's CS 229 Machine Learning
System design interview for IT companies
Learn how to design large-scale systems. Prep for the system design interview. Includes Anki flashcards.
Preparation links and resources for system design questions
This project involved implementation of a new system call in Linux kernel that takes two or more input files, merge-sorts them, and produces an output file. All checks and validations were done at the system level. "flags" also supported to determine various options of sorting. Tools and Technologies: C (Linux Kernel Programming)
Zookeeper:Distributed Process Coordination中文译本
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.